The vast majority of development in Lab Grown diamonds is in the production of colorless diamonds.
The processes to make diamonds blue are well known. Resources have been devoted to pink lab grown diamonds.
Yellow? It's just not common to find lab grown yellow diamonds. The majority have a prominent orange tint. This diamond escapes that - it looks very much like a natural vivid yellow.
